Business Context and Reporting Period
This Form 8-K is filed by Rexahn Pharmaceuticals, Inc. (not Opus Genetics, Inc.) for the period ending September 21, 2009, reporting events occurring on September 16, 2009. The filing discloses the consummation of a stock purchase transaction and the unredacted identity of a partner in a prior research agreement.
Key Financial Metrics and Transaction Details
- Transaction Type: Unregistered sale of equity securities and entry into a material definitive agreement.
- Investor: Teva Pharmaceutical Industries Limited.
- Shares Sold: 3,102,837 shares of Common Stock.
- Price Per Share: $1.128.
- Total Consideration Received: $3,500,000.
- Underlying Asset: Development of RX-3117, a nucleoside compound with anti-metabolite mechanism for cancer treatment.
Material Changes and Future Obligations
The primary material change is the disclosure of Teva Pharmaceutical Industries Limited as the counterparty to agreements previously filed with redacted identities. Additionally, the filing outlines future funding options:
- Second Tranche Option: Teva has the option to purchase additional shares valued at $750,000 plus anticipated development costs. The price will be 120% of the closing price prior to purchase, subject to a 7% ownership cap.
- Additional Funding: If further funding is required after the second tranche, Teva may provide it in exchange for shares at 100% of the closing price, also subject to the 7% ownership cap.
Guidance, Risks, and Contingencies
The filing does not provide specific financial guidance, revenue forecasts, or management commentary on future performance beyond the transaction terms. Key contingencies include:
- The success of the development of the RX-3117 compound.
- Teva's exercise of options to purchase additional shares, which depends on development cost requirements and market prices.
- Compliance with the 7% ownership limitation for future share issuances.
